Past President's Farewell Address

Dr. Rilwan Adegboyega

Past President (2025 - 2026)

Dear Esteemed Colleagues,

As I conclude my tenure as President of the Association of Resident Doctors, Federal Medical Centre, Abeokuta, I am filled with immense gratitude and pride for what we have collectively achieved during this remarkable journey.

🎯 Reflections on Our Journey

When I assumed office, we set out with a clear vision: to strengthen our association, improve the welfare of our members, and enhance the quality of healthcare delivery at FMC Abeokuta. Today, I am proud to say that we have made significant strides in achieving these goals.

🏆 Key Achievements

  • Member Welfare: Successfully advocated for improved working conditions and timely payment of salaries and allowances.
  • Academic Development: Organized regular CMEs, workshops, and training programs to enhance clinical skills and knowledge. Provision of internet service for enhancement of research and training as well as setting up protocols through the academic committee to improve training of members, amongst others
  • Infrastructure: Upgraded the ARD Lounge and improved facilities for resident doctors.
  • Advocacy: Strengthened our relationship with hospital management, NARD, and other stakeholders.
  • Unity: Fostered a spirit of camaraderie and collaboration among all members.
  • Social Responsibility: Engaged in community health outreach programs and public health initiatives.
